			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>The Park:</strong> Beaverton City Park features a shooting fountain, perfect for a hot day!  Dress accordingly!  There are lots of places to sit and relax!</p>
<p><strong>Located at:</strong> 5<sup>th</sup> and Watson by the Beaverton Library.</p>
<p><strong>A Fun Picnic Theme: </strong>The water cycle</p>
<p><strong>What to Picnic:</strong></p>
<p>–         Dehydrated fruit=water cycle elements</p>
<p>–         Water, duh!</p>
<p>–         Popsicles, frozen state</p>
<p><strong>What to Play:</strong></p>
<p>–         Have your child watch drops of water fall on the ground then wait for them to dry up, explain evaporation.</p>
<p>–         Learn about the water cycle <a href="http://ga.water.usgs.gov/edu/watercyclesummary.html">here</a>.</p>
<p>–         Earlier in the week have your child make ice cubes to take in a water bottle to the park.  Teach them about the different states of water. solid-liquid-gas</p>
<p>–         Anything you picnic requires water to get to your plate, explain in each instance how water was involved.</p>
<p>–         Take your child to the library and do a little research!</p>
<p>–         Water-balloon toss, squirt guns, or other water games.</p>
<p>–         Bring water toys, children love filling buckets, measuring cups, sponges, or whatever you can find!</p>
<p>–         Don’t forget to bring towels, or to explain why evaporation can make you shiver!  Brrrrrr!</p>
